Transaction 734aa2edc510629ccf0459f83f5b7e272da5c60635a233bfb72fb095dfe0948c

1 Input
2 Outputs
  • 734aa2edc510629ccf0459f83f5b7e272da5c60635a233bfb72fb095dfe0948c:0
  • value  93697
    address  13vDftFKCWVRU9BnMthjXSnrtUj5PGSAVg
  • 734aa2edc510629ccf0459f83f5b7e272da5c60635a233bfb72fb095dfe0948c:1
  • value  18950334
    address  3LhSHp6tJtceQzSpd1r5FZLwyYoLpsS3u3